BRIDGEPORT, Conn. (AP) _ A Stamford woman was sentenced for forging her daughter's checks and depositing them into her own bank account.

Lia Russo Gomez yesterday was sentenced to a year and a day.

The Stamford woman and her daughter who was nine years old at the time were injured in an airline crash on Long Island that killed 73 other passengers in 1990.

Gomez received an 850-thousand dollar settlement. Her daughter was awarded about eight thousand three hundred dollars a month from the ages of 18 to 25.

But prosecutors say Gomez told her daughter the checks came every two months. She forged 29 of her daughter's checks for four years, acquiring more than 241-thousand dollars.

Gomez says she began taking the checks when she ran into financial problems on investment properties. Her lawyer says she used them to support her family.
